Transaction 2f4c26a743730764b3f62d21fd940c757cc3314f7ac0e87b73cd24e5c2e4136c

6 Input
2 Outputs
  • 2f4c26a743730764b3f62d21fd940c757cc3314f7ac0e87b73cd24e5c2e4136c:0
  • value  1005052
    address  1D988zx3G88Pk3s744wvT9h2GyHUAXqG7c
  • 2f4c26a743730764b3f62d21fd940c757cc3314f7ac0e87b73cd24e5c2e4136c:1
  • value  58621026
    address  1GJKb7bcKwZ8WNJMp4iqDpW1Wmd8zKpXqP